Description
Responsibilities
• Work with VP Sales to consistently analyse the sales processes to successfully shorten sales cycles, achieve repeatability and yield high close rates.
• Provide vital, consistent, accurate & timely data and analysis that help meet the Company’s goals and objectives.
• Support as required any commercial items in Salesforce and RFP processes.
• Build and maintain accurate detailed reporting models including but not limited to; visibility into projected trending, win/loss analysis, client, stage, channel and solution trends, segmented revenue, and sales metrics.
• Develop and maintain strong relationships with Senior Executives, Sales, Professional Services, & Finance.
• Build Opportunity Analyses Reports which help support business decisions on sales strategies, solution types and market or customer trends.
• Manage the global Price Book onboarding process into Salesforce.
• Development of an employee-oriented company culture that emphasizes quality, continuous improvement, key employee retention and development, and high performance .
